Rajiformes

Belongs within: Chondrichthyes.Contains: Raja, Bathyraja, Dipturus, Leucoraja. The Rajiformes are fairly generalised rays with head, body and pectoral fins combined into a flat disc, and a slender tail bearing very small dorsal and caudal fins but lacking stinging spines. Myliobatiformes

Belongs within: Chondrichthyes.Contains: Myliobatidae, Urolophus, Himantura, Dasyatis, Gymnuridae, Potamotrygonidae. The Myliobatiformes are a group of rays with large pectoral fins combining with the head to form a broad disc, a slender tail often bearing strong stinging spines, and caudal and dorsal fins reduced or absent (Bond 1996). Pantestuguria

Belongs within: Centrocryptodira.Contains: Batagurinae, Testudinidae, Geoemyda. The Testudinoidae is a proposed clade uniting the land tortoises of the Testudinidae with the Asian pond turtles of the paraphyletic ‘Bataguridae’. The monophyly of this clade is unsettled, as proposed synapomorphies are also found in other testudinates, and are not universal within testudinoidaens (Gaffney & Meylan 1988). Syngnathidae

Belongs within: Syngnathoidei.Contains: Gastrophori, Corythoichthys, Urophori. The Syngnathidae, pipefishes and seahorses, are small, long-bodied fish with the body encased in dermal plates. Characters (Berg 1940): Two nasal openings on each side. Body completely covered with dermal plates. Dorsal fin, if present, single, without spines. Ventrals absent. Gill openings dorsal, very small. Lophiiformes

Belongs within: Eupercaria.Contains: Antennarioidei, Ceratioidei. The Lophiiformes, anglerfishes and related taxa, are marine fishes with a spinous dorsal fin composed of one to a few flexible rays, some of which may be modified into a fishing apparatus (Bond 1996).
